The saddest part for me is I think they could still make a run with a few key adjustments, but they just stick with what doesn't work and die a slow death on offense and continue to make curious decisions on offense.

If on defense, they would simply use their 3 first round picks at CB to play man (and I am hoping Dennard will take the job from an injured Dre and never look back) and use one of the safeties (preferably Fej) in the box to help cover short routes and stuff the running game.  Also, have WJIII travel with the other team's best WR.  While we are at it, increase the blitz % two-fold.  We might actually get more out of these guys if they are playing more aggressive and not forcing the back end to cover all day (which they aren't able to).

On offense, target getting John Ross 10 touches a game.  Jet sweeps, screens, slants, and the occasional deep shot...but right now, they are pigeon holing him to take the proverbial top off the defense and ignoring his phone-booth quicks.  

Increase the rushing attack % and work with play-action.  Just because the rushing attack doesn't work early doesn't mean they can't wear people down.  If Ross is used even as a decoy on jet sweeps, it will force LBs to fear the outside rush and slow their gap pressure.  

It isn't rocket science, and even Tony Pike echoed some of these sentiments and in his words "I can't believe they don't even try it".

Me either.  Then again....
